repo.or.cz
/
marionette.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Remove region.c; use map_mem in loadelf.c
2009-02-05
Josh
u
a Phillips
Remo
v
e
r
egion
.
c
;
use m
a
p_mem
in lo
a
delf
.
c
commit
|
commitdiff
|
tree
2009-02-05
Josh
u
a Phillips
Move
d
PA
G
E_SIZE to kernel/archinf
.
h
commit
|
commitdiff
|
tree
2009-02-05
Joshua Phillips
Added d
o
cumentatio
n
ab
o
u
t
the memory ma
n
age
r
commit
|
commitdiff
|
tree
2009-02-05
J
o
s
hua Phillips
Use
uintptr_t,
n
ot intptr_t, for mem
o
ry
ad
d
res
s
es!
commit
|
commitdiff
|
tree
2009-02-05
J
oshua Phillips
map_
m
em is working; reflexive mapping is disa
b
le
d
.
commit
|
commitdiff
|
tree
2009-02-05
J
o
shua P
h
illip
s
R
e
moved redundant de
c
laration i
n
buddy
.
c
commit
|
commitdiff
|
tree
2009-02-05
Jo
s
hua
P
h
illips
Sma
l
l cons
t
/
not-const fi
x
in read
-
m
ultiboot
.
c
commit
|
commitdiff
|
tree
2009-02-05
Joshu
a
Phillips
Q
u
ick
s
i
g
ned
/
unsigned fix in buddy
.
c
commit
|
commitdiff
|
tree
2009-02-05
Joshu
a
Phillips
linker
.
ld: use all
.
data*
an
d
.
bss
*
sections
commit
|
commitdiff
|
tree
2009-02-05
Josh
u
a
Phillips
Wrote ma
p
_mem wit
h
out using re
c
ursive mapping
.
commit
|
commitdiff
|
tree
2009-02-05
Joshua P
h
illi
p
s
Create
d
PDE_N_
*
mac
r
os
commit
|
commitdiff
|
tree
2009-02-05
Joshua
Phillips
In
i
ti
a
lise an empty pagedir structure
.
commit
|
commitdiff
|
tree
2009-02-04
J
oshua Phil
l
ips
(broken
)
renamed mm
.
{c,h} -> allocatio
n
.
{c,h}
commit
|
commitdiff
|
tree
2009-02-04
Jos
h
ua P
h
illips
Move
k
e
rn
e
l/lib
c
/ ->
l
i
bc/
commit
|
commitdiff
|
tree
2009-02-04
Joshua Phi
l
lips
Removed overly-verbose prints a
n
d
traces
.
commit
|
commitdiff
|
tree
2009-02-04
Jo
s
hua
P
hilli
p
s
Moved pani
c
/trace and
out of con
s
o
l
e
.
h
.
commit
|
commitdiff
|
tree
2009-02-04
J
oshua Philli
p
s
Added hardware/read-multib
o
ot
.
{
c
,h}
commit
|
commitdiff
|
tree
2009-02-04
Jo
s
hua Phillip
s
Use Bochs's port e9 hack for
trace messages
commit
|
commitdiff
|
tree
2009-02-04
Joshua Phillips
Added TRACE
macro (tra
c
e
.
c)
commit
|
commitdiff
|
tree
2009-02-04
Jos
h
u
a
Phillips
Add se
r
i
a
l
_
i
s_i
n
itiali
z
ed
commit
|
commitdiff
|
tree
2009-02-04
Jos
h
ua
P
hillips
A
d
d
e
d strcat/str
n
cat
commit
|
commitdiff
|
tree
2009-02-04
Joshu
a
Phillips
Comment
s
in star
t
.
S
commit
|
commitdiff
|
tree
2009-02-04
Joshua Phil
l
ips
Use _B
o
ol instead
o
f 'unsig
n
ed char' for
bool ty
p
e
commit
|
commitdiff
|
tree
2009-02-02
Joshua P
h
illips
(broken) not sure
what's goi
n
g
on her
e
commit
|
commitdiff
|
tree
2009-02-02
Joshua Ph
i
llips
S
i
mpler s
y
scall c
o
de
.
commit
|
commitdiff
|
tree
2009-02-02
Joshua Phi
l
lips
Carefully ensur
e
d isrs > 0x
8
0 a
r
e
e
quisized
.
commit
|
commitdiff
|
tree
2009-02-01
Joshua P
h
illips
(broken) Add
e
d s
y
s
_exit system call
.
commit
|
commitdiff
|
tree
2009-02-01
Joshua
P
hillips
Load E
L
F multi
b
oot module
i
nto
memory
.
commit
|
commitdiff
|
tree
2009-02-01
Joshua P
h
illips
addr_t -> int
p
tr_t
commit
|
commitdiff
|
tree
2009-02-01
J
oshua Phill
i
ps
Added 'init'
m
o
d
ule
commit
|
commitdiff
|
tree
2008-12-12
J
o
s
h
ua Phillips
Starte
d
setting u
p
t
h
reads f
o
r
u
ser-space
e
xecution
.
commit
|
commitdiff
|
tree
2008-12-12
Joshu
a
P
h
illips
Allocat
e
d
GDT, IDT
a
nd TSS in its o
w
n
p
age, so that
.
.
.
commit
|
commitdiff
|
tree
2008-12-12
Josh
u
a Ph
i
llips
Removed exc
e
ssive trace
m
e
ss
a
g
e
s
from threading code
.
commit
|
commitdiff
|
tree
2008-12-12
Jos
h
ua Phillips
A
d
ded
t
hread pre-emption
commit
|
commitdiff
|
tree
2008-12-12
Joshua
P
hillips
Added c
o
ntext-sw
i
t
ching and a yield() func
t
ion
.
commit
|
commitdiff
|
tree
2008-12-09
Joshua Phi
l
lips
Start
e
d wo
r
king on th
r
eading
.
commit
|
commitdiff
|
tree
2008-12-09
Joshua Phil
l
ips
Added
P
IT (p
r
o
g
ram
m
able interrupt ti
m
er) support
.
commit
|
commitdiff
|
tree
2008-12-09
Joshua
P
hilli
p
s
Removed superfluous tra
c
e
() commands from memo
r
y
ma
n
agement
.
commit
|
commitdiff
|
tree
2008-12-09
Joshu
a
Phillips
Fix
e
d pa
g
eta
b
l
e-creatio
n
code;
enabled WP (wri
t
e-protect
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
Joshua
Phillips
Added
m
emory ma
n
ageme
n
t
c
ode, memory
r
egion managemen
t
.
.
.
commit
|
commitdiff
|
tree
2008-12-08
J
o
shua Ph
i
ll
i
ps
Added an in
t
errupt system
.
commit
|
commitdiff
|
tree
2008-12-08
Joshua Phi
l
lip
s
Set up a G
D
T (g
l
o
b
al de
s
cri
p
tor ta
b
le
)
commit
|
commitdiff
|
tree
2008-12-08
J
oshua Phillips
Fix
e
d panic()
commit
|
commitdiff
|
tree
2008-12-08
Jos
h
u
a
Phillip
s
A
d
ded mult
i
boot-header re
a
ding
code
.
commit
|
commitdiff
|
tree
2008-12-08
Joshua Phillips
A
d
de
d
budd
y
alloc
a
tion algorithm
.
commit
|
commitdiff
|
tree
2008-12-05
Joshua Phillips
In
i
tial project
.
commit
|
commitdiff
|
tree